CODEBASE-Okinawa / codebase-tech-training

CODEBASEのテクトレのリポジトリ
4 stars 0 forks source link

Railsの開発環境をDockerコンテナとdocker-compose使って開発、毎回ビルドしない方法を考える、docker-syncを使って高速化 #39

Open aokabin opened 4 years ago

aokabin commented 4 years ago

同じ環境を複数、大量に作成できる

チーム開発時に、全く同じ環境でアプリケーション開発をするための基盤ができるので、自分が作るアプリケーションの開発の手伝いをしてもらいやすくなる(ハズ)

例えば、アプリケーションを数名で開発する場合、同じ開発環境が整っているとは限らない なので、同じ環境を簡単に作れる仕組みがあると、開発人数がスケールできるようになる

Dockerを使っていれば、開発したものを本番環境にアップロードするのもシームレスに実行できる

便利だー

takara1111 commented 4 years ago

リポジトリ: (リポジトリの最初のissueのURL) https://github.com/takara1356/Rails_ECS_ECR/issues

自分なりのゴール: まずはアプリをコンテナ化。 その後CircleCI・ECR・ECSを連携させてCI/CD環境を構築する!

この課題を選んだ理由: 自分でアプリ開発しても、デプロイ作業がネックになって開発速度が落ちるのが悩ましい... Pushするだけで本番環境にデプロイされる環境を構築して開発に集中したい!

Main Isuue https://github.com/takara1356/Rails_ECS_ECR/issues